African Humid Period
The African humid period (AHP) is a climate period in Africa during the late Pleistocene and Holocene geologic epochs, when northern Africa was wetter than today. The covering of much of the Sahara desert by grasses, trees and lakes was caused by changes in Earth's orbit around the Sun; changes in vegetation and dust in the Sahara which strengthened the African monsoon; and increased greenhouse gases, which may, or may not imply that anthropogenic global warming could result in a shrinkage of the Sahara desert. During the preceding last glacial maximum, the Sahara contained extensive dune fields and was mostly uninhabited. It was much larger than today, but its lakes and rivers such as Lake Victoria and the White Nile were either dry or at low levels. The humid period began about 14,600–14,500 years ago at the end of Heinrich event 1, simultaneously to the Bølling-Allerød warming. Rivers and lakes such as Lake Chad formed or expanded, glaciers grew on Mount Kilimanjaro and the Sahara retreated. Two major dry fluctuations occurred; during the Younger Dryas and the short 8.2 kiloyear event. The African humid period ended 6,000–5,000 years ago during the Piora Oscillation cold period. While some evidence points to an end 5,500 years ago, in the Sahel, Arabia and East Africa the period appears to have taken place in several steps such as the 4.2 kiloyear event. The AHP led to a widespread settlement of the Sahara and the Arabian Deserts, and had a profound effect on African cultures, such as the birth of the Pharaonic civilization. They lived as hunter-gatherers until the agricultural revolution and domesticated cattle, goats and sheep. They left archeological sites and artifacts such as one of the oldest ships in the world, and rock paintings such as those in the Cave of Swimmers and in the Acacus Mountains. Earlier humid periods in Africa were postulated after the discovery of these rock paintings in now-inhospitable parts of the Sahara. When the period ended, humans gradually abandoned the desert in favour of regions with more secure water supplies, such as the Nile Valley and Mesopotamia, where they gave rise to early complex societies.

Phanerozoic
The Phanerozoic Eon is the current geologic eon in the geologic time scale, and the one during which abundant animal and plant life has existed. It covers 541 million years to the present and began with the Cambrian Period when animals first developed hard shells preserved in the fossil record. The time before the Phanerozoic, called the Precambrian, is now divided into the Hadean, Archaean and Proterozoic eons. The time span of the Phanerozoic starts with the sudden appearance of fossilized evidence of a number of animal phyla; the evolution of those phyla into diverse forms; the emergence and development of complex plants; the evolution of fish; the emergence of insects and tetrapods; and the development of modern fauna. Plant life on land appeared in the early Phanerozoic eon. During this time span, tectonic forces caused the continents to move and eventually collect into a single landmass known as Pangaea (the most recent supercontinent), which then separated into the current continental landmasses.

Meanings of Minor Planet Names: 1–1000
As minor planet discoveries are confirmed, they are given a permanent number by the IAU's Minor Planet Center (MPC), and the discoverers can then submit names for them, following the IAU's naming conventions. The list below concerns those minor planets in the specified number-range that have received names, and explains the meanings of those names. Official naming citations of newly named small Solar System bodies are published in MPC's Minor Planet Circulars several times a year. Recent citations can also be found on the JPL Small-Body Database (SBDB). Until his death in 2016, German astronomer Lutz D. Schmadel compiled these citations into the Dictionary of Minor Planet Names (DMP) and regularly updated the collection. Based on Paul Herget's The Names of the Minor Planets, Schmadel also researched the unclear origin of numerous asteroids, most of which had been named prior to World War II.  This article incorporates public domain material from the United States Government document "SBDB". New namings may only be added after official publication as the preannouncement of names is condemned by the Committee on Small Body Nomenclature.

Honda Civic Hybrid
The Honda Civic Hybrid is a variation of the Honda Civic with a hybrid electric powertrain. Honda introduced the Civic Hybrid in Japan in December 2001 and discontinued it in 2015. In the United States, it was the first hybrid automobile to be certified as an Advanced Technology Partial Zero-Emissions Vehicle (AT-PZEV) from the California Air Resources Board (CARB). The Civic Hybrid uses an Integrated Motor Assist hybrid system similar to that of the Honda Insight. The Civic Hybrid was only marketed in sedan configurations.

IKCO EF Engines
IKCO EF engines are a family of four-cylinder engines. The EF7 series are designed jointly by Iran Khodro Powertrain Company (IPCO) and F.E.V GmbH of Germany. The other models will be designed by IPCO itself. IPCO is the powertrain designing & producing company of Iranian car manufacturer Iran Khodro (IKCO). IKCO aims to supply 800,000 powertrains by 2010. The first phase of IKCO EF Engines project (EF7 Dual-Fuel) investments were about 80 million US$. EF4 & EF7 engines use CNG as their main fuel and they can also use gasoline. EFD is the first engine of the EF family that is single-fuel. It uses high-quality diesel (Euro 4 Quality or better) as fuel. EF engines share most of their parts between them. It was IKCO's aim to reduce costs and provide ease of supplying the parts in the future for after-sales services. The EF family dual-fuel and petrol-fuel engines have achieved the Euro IV emission standard and are able to achieve Euro V emission standard with some minor changes but EFD will be the first engine of the family which comes with the Euro IV emission standard as its first release, and is able to achieve the Euro VI emission standard with some changes. The most important suppliers for EF engines are INA for sensitive VVT parts and some other mechanical parts, MAHLE which supplies some important parts of the engine family such as pistons, with Bosch supplying the ECU and electrically controlled pedal and lots of other important sensitive electronic parts. Almost all of the parts (except high-tech and sensitive parts) from worldwide well-known companies (as mentioned) are produced in Iran under license with the highest required quality for the engines. The Germany company Bosch had shown interest in assembling the Iranian engine under license. In 2008 IKCO has announced that EF7 is among the three best CNG-based engines of the world in designing.

Physiological Effects of Marijuana
To understand the impact of marijuana on the cardiovascular system, it is imperative to understand the endocannabinoid system. The endocannabinoid system (ECS) is comprised of the endocannabinoids anandamide and 2-arachidonylglycerol (both of which are endogenous lipid mediators), their metabolic enzymes, and G-protein coupled cannabinoid receptor 1 (CB1R) plus G-protein coupled cannabinoid receptor 2 (CB2R) [24]. CB1R is the primary receptor that mediates the effects of marijuana. CB1R is present in the brain, heart, vascular smooth muscle, and peripheral nervous system [6]. Its extensive presence in the human body makes its activation wide-reaching and impacts multiple systems.

Information and Communications Technology
Information and communications technology (ICT) is an extensional term for information technology (IT) that stresses the role of unified communications and the integration of telecommunications (telephone lines and wireless signals) and computers, as well as necessary enterprise software, middleware, storage and audiovisual, that enable users to access, store, transmit, understand and manipulate information. ICT is also used to refer to the convergence of audiovisuals and telephone networks with computer networks through a single cabling or link system. There are large economic incentives to merge the telephone networks with the computer network system using a single unified system of cabling, signal distribution, and management. ICT is an umbrella term that includes any communication device, encompassing radio, televiision, cell phones, computer and network hardware, satellite systems and so on, as well as the various services and appliances with them such as video conferencing and distance learning. ICT also includes analog technology, such as paper communication, and any mode that transmits communication. ICT is a broad subject and the concepts are evolving. It covers any product that will store, retrieve, manipulate, transmit, or receive information electronically in a digital form (e.g., personal computers including smartphones, digital television, email, or robots). Skills Framework for the Information Age is one of many models for describing and managing competencies for ICT professionals for the 21st century.

Working Principle of Hydraulic Control System
Hydraulic control systems are a feedback control system that uses hydraulic components as control and execution components, and hydraulic oil as the working medium for energy transmission. The movement of hydraulic actuators refers to the system output (including displacement, velocity, acceleration, and force), which is transmitted to the controller through feedback components. The input signal of the control component is adjusted according to the error size, so that the system output can automatically, quickly, and accurately track the system input instructions. Hydraulic control systems are classified into pump-controlled hydraulic control systems and valve-controlled hydraulic control systems based on their various control modes and valve components.

Multifactor Leadership Questionnaire
The Multifactor Leadership Questionnaire (MLQ) is a psychological inventory consisting of 36 items pertaining to leadership styles and 9 items pertaining to leadership outcomes. The MLQ was constructed by Bruce J. Avolio and Bernard M. Bass with the goal to assess a full range of leadership styles. The MLQ is composed of 9 scales that measure three leadership styles: transformational leadership (5 scales), transactional leadership (2 scales), and passive/avoidant behavior (2 scales), and 3 scales that measure outcomes of leadership. The MLQ takes an average of 15 minutes to complete and can be administered to an individual or group. The MLQ can be used to differentiate effective and ineffective leaders at all organizational levels and has been validated across many cultures and types of organizations. It is used for leadership development and research. The MLQ is designed as a multi-rater (or 360-degree) instrument, meaning that the leadership assessment considers the leader's self-assessment alongside the assessments of their leadership from their superiors, peers, subordinates, and others. The Leader (Self) Form and the Rater Form of the MLQ can be completed and assessed separately - however validity is much weaker when assessing leadership using only the Leader (Self) Form. Following the publication of the original MLQ in 1990, new versions of the MLQ were gradually developed to fit different assessment needs. The current versions of the MLQ are: Multifactor Leadership Questionnaire 360 (MLQ 360), Multifactor Leadership Questionnaire Self Form (MLQ Self), Multifactor Leadership Questionnaire Rater Form (MLQ Rater Form), Team Multifactor Leadership Questionnaire (TMLQ), and Multifactor Leadership Questionnaire Actual vs. Ought. All MLQ versions are protected by copyright law and published by Mind Garden, Inc. The MLQ underwent a re-branding for its scales in 2015 with the justification of replacing the heavily-academic scale names with terms that would be more widely and easily understood by those outside of academia, such as business leaders and consultants. Recent academic research using the MLQ continue to use the original scale names. The MLQ is often combined with the Authentic Leadership Questionnaire (ALQ) to assess the self-awareness, transparency, ethics/morality, and processing ability of leaders (the ALQ was constructed by Avolio with William L. Gardner and Fred O. Walumbwa in 2007).

Club of Rome
Founded in 1968 at Accademia dei Lincei in Rome, Italy, the Club of Rome consists of current and former heads of state, UN bureaucrats, high-level politicians and government officials, diplomats, scientists, economists, and business leaders from around the globe. It stimulated considerable public attention in 1972 with the first report to the Club of Rome, The Limits to Growth. Since 1 July 2008 the organization has been based in Winterthur, Switzerland.

Shallow Affect
Reduced affect display, sometimes referred to as emotional blunting, is a condition of reduced emotional reactivity in an individual. It manifests as a failure to express feelings (affect display) either verbally or nonverbally, especially when talking about issues that would normally be expected to engage the emotions. Expressive gestures are rare and there is little animation in facial expression or vocal inflection. Reduced affect can be symptomatic of autism, schizophrenia, depression, posttraumatic stress disorder, depersonalization disorder, schizoid personality disorder or brain damage. It may also be a side effect of certain medications (e.g., antipsychotics and antidepressants). Reduced affect should be distinguished from apathy and anhedonia, which explicitly refer to a lack of emotion, whereas reduced affect is a lack of emotional expression (affect display) regardless of whether emotion (underlying affect) is actually reduced or not.

Types of Adsorbents
There are two types of adsorbents, namely, natural and synthetic adsorbents. Several examples of natural adsorbents include clay and zeolite (abundant and cheap). On the other hand, researchers can produce synthetic adsorbents (activated carbon) via agricultural waste, industrial waste, and household waste.
